Prevent sinking coord calculation for sample (#3655)

The mark convergent pass is meant to prevent unwanted moving of
operations on derivative op input. It was previously only run on pixel
shaders. Because derivatives are supported in CS/MS/AS shaders as part
of shader model 6.6, it needs to be run on these stages for that target
too.

lib/HLSL/DxilConvergent.cpp

@@ -47,7 +47,8 @@ public:
 
   bool runOnModule(Module &M) override {
     if (M.HasHLModule()) {
-      if (!M.GetHLModule().GetShaderModel()->IsPS())
+      const ShaderModel *SM = M.GetHLModule().GetShaderModel();
+      if (!SM->IsPS() && (!SM->IsSM66Plus() || (!SM->IsCS() && !SM->IsMS() && !SM->IsAS())))
         return false;
     }
     bool bUpdated = false;
